/*
@author: name
*/
body{font:14px/1.5 "Microsoft YaHei","\5FAE\8F6F\96C5\9ED1,\9ED1\4F53","Heiti SC",tahoma,arial,Hiragino Sans GB,"\5B8B\4F53",sans-serif;margin:0 auto;color:#333;min-width:1200px;}
p,ul,ol,dl,dt,dd,h1,h2,h3,h4,h5,h6,form,input,select,button,textarea,iframe{margin:0; padding:0;}
img{border:0 none;vertical-align:top;}
ul,li,ol{list-style-type:none;}
i,em,address, caption, cite, code, dfn, th, var {font-style: normal;}
a{text-decoration:none;color:#333;}
input,textarea,a,a:hover{outline:none;}
textarea{resize:none;}
.clearfix:after{content:".";display:block;height:0;clear: both;visibility:hidden;}
.clearfix{*zoom:1;}
.fl{float:left; _display:inline;}
.fr{float:right; _display:inline;}
.pr{position:relative;}
.abs{position:absolute;}
.layout{width:1200px;margin:0 auto;}
.ml20{margin-left: 20px;}
.hide{display: none;}

.header-wrap{background:#ffffff;}
.headerBg{height: 299px;background: url(//www.chinaacc.com/upload/resources/image/2022/10/20/1915457.png) no-repeat center top #3361ff;}
.mod1Con{background-color: #ffffff;border-radius: 10px;margin: 30px 0;box-shadow: 0 0 10px #f0f0f0;padding: 50px 50px 42px 50px;}
.module1ConBox h2{font-size: 24px;color: #333333;font-weight: bold;}
.module1ConBox{margin-bottom: 50px;}
.module1ConBox ul{margin-top: 35px;}
.module1ConBox ul li{float: left;font-size: 18px;color: #333333;background: url(/images/chujizhicheng/zhuanti/pinggu/check.png) no-repeat left center;padding-left: 25px;margin-right: 50px;cursor: pointer;}
.module1ConBox ul li.on{background: url(/images/chujizhicheng/zhuanti/pinggu/checkon.png) no-repeat left center;}
.module1ConBox p.tips{ padding-top:10px; color:#666;}
.module1Bth{text-align: center;}
.module1Bth a{display: inline-block;font-size: 22px;color: #ffffff;font-weight: bold;text-align: center;width: 332px;height:52px;line-height: 52px;border-radius: 40px;background: url(/images/chujizhicheng/zhuanti/pinggu/bthIcon.png) no-repeat 280px bottom #3393ff;}

.module2{margin: 30px 0;}
.mod2Con{height: 477px;width: 1230px;margin:0 auto;background: url(/images/chujizhicheng/zhuanti/pinggu/mod2Bg.png) no-repeat 0 0;}
.mod2ConLeft h2{font-size: 24px;color: #333333;font-weight: bold;padding-top: 85px;padding-bottom: 20px;}
.mod2ConLeft{width: 436px;text-align: center;margin-left: 620px;}
.module2Bth a{display: block;font-size: 22px;color: #ffffff;width: 331px;height: 51px;line-height: 51px;background-color: #3393ff;text-align: center;border-radius: 40px;margin:20px auto 0;}
.module2Text p{font-size: 14px;color: #999999;padding-top: 35px;}

.module2BannerPic{margin-top: 20px;border-radius: 10px;box-shadow: 0 0 10px #f0f0f0;border-radius: 10px;}
.module2BannerPic a{display: block;height: 80px;width: 100%;}
.module2BannerPic a img{width: 100%;height: 100%;border-radius: 10px;}

.viewPopMask {
  width: 100%;
  height: 100%;
  position: fixed;
  left: 0;
  top: 0;
  right: 0;
  bottom: 0;
  background: #000;
  opacity: .7;
  filter: alpha(opacity=70);
  z-index: 99;
}
.viewPop{position: fixed;top:50%;left: 50%;background-color: #ffffff;border-radius: 10px;z-index: 999;}
.promptPop{width: 446px;height: 254px;margin-left: -223px;margin-top:-127px;text-align: center;}
.promptPop h2{color: #333333;font-size: 18px;font-weight: bold;padding-top: 55px;}
.promptPop p{text-align: center;font-size: 14px;color: #333333;padding-top: 30px;}
.promptPopBth{text-align: center;margin-top: 40px;}
.promptPopBth a{display: inline-block;width: 160px;height: 42px;background-color: #3393ff;text-align: center;line-height: 42px;border-radius: 40px;font-size: 18px;color: #ffffff;}

.signupPop{width: 446px;height: 510px;margin-left: -223px;margin-top:-255px;}
.signupPopTit{height: 50px;}
.signupPopTit a {
  display: inline-block;
  width: 16px;
  height: 50px;
  background: url(/images/chujizhicheng/zhuanti/pinggu/closeBth.png) center center no-repeat;
  float: right;
  margin-right: 20px;
}
.signupPopH2{font-size: 20px;color: #333333;font-weight: bold;text-align: center;}
.signupPopCon{padding: 0 30px;height: 345px;overflow-y: auto;}
.signupPopCon h2{color: #333333;font-weight: bold;font-size: 14px;padding-top: 20px;padding-bottom: 10px;}
.signupPopCon p{font-size: 14px;color: #333333;line-height: 24px;}
.signupPopBth{text-align: center;margin-top: 27px;}
.signupPopBth a{background-color: #3393ff;color: #ffffff;font-size: 18px;border-radius: 40px;padding:10px 60px;}

.loginLink {
  position: absolute;
  width: 100%;
  height: 100%;
  top: 0;
  left: 0;
}